Hellam Township, Hallam Borough, and Wrightsville Borough are embarking on an exciting journey to shape the future of your community through the development of a multi-municipal comprehensive plan! A comprehensive plan is a strategic document that will outline the collective vision of all three municipalities for growth, development, and sustainability. It serves as a guide...

If you come across a dead deer on your property or on the road, contact Tom Marsh 484-571-2092. Tom is contracted through the PA Game Commission to assist with roadkill removal in the township. Call or text him at 484-571-2092 to schedule a pick up time and location.
